Yokohama grew from a small fishing village into Japan's first major treaty port after 1859, when the country reopened to foreign trade and the harbour filled with Western merchants, consulates and Japan's earliest gas lamps, railways and daily newspaper. That cosmopolitan start still shows in the bluff mansions of Yamate, the largest Chinatown in Japan and the brick customs warehouses of the old port. Rebuilt after the 1923 Great Kanto earthquake and wartime damage, the city reinvented its waterfront as Minato Mirai, a skyline of towers, a giant Ferris wheel and long harbour promenades. For a dog owner Yokohama is one of Japan's easier big cities: its highlights are outdoors and close together along a flat, walkable bayfront, with a large natural-grass dog run at Rinko Park, though the same strict Japanese rules apply, carriers on trains, leashes everywhere and few indoor venues open to pets.
A large roughly 4,000 mยฒ all natural-grass dog run on the bayfront at Rinko Park in Minato Mirai, five minutes from Minatomirai Station. Off-leash inside; it opens on scheduled dates and commonly asks for vaccination proof at entry.
Yokohama's landmark 1930 seafront park, a long ribbon of lawns, rose beds and monuments facing the harbour and the Hikawa Maru liner. Leashed dogs are welcome on the wide promenade; keep them leashed and clean up after them.
A pedestrian promenade laid out on an old harbour railway, crossing three preserved iron bridges between Sakuragicho and Minato Mirai. A flat, scenic on-leash route that links the main dog-friendly seafront sights.
Two restored early-1900s customs warehouses on the Shinko waterfront. The wide brick plazas and outdoor lawns suit a leashed-dog stroll with harbour views; the indoor shops and halls are generally off-limits to pets.
The international passenger pier, whose undulating wooden roof nicknamed the whale's back is a free open-air deck with views of the Minato Mirai skyline. A favourite leashed-dog walk, best at sunset; little shade, so bring water.
A superb traditional Japanese garden in Honmoku, with ponds, a pagoda and relocated historic houses, glorious in autumn. Like most classic Japanese gardens it does not admit dogs, worth noting so you do not arrive with a pet.
